Python Numpy ndarray.dot()

Python Numpy ndarray.dot()

numpy.ndarray.dot()函数返回两个数组的点积。

语法: numpy.ndarray.dot(arr, out=None)

参数 :
arr : [array_like] 输入阵列。
out : [ndarray, optional] 输出参数。

返回: [ndarray] 两个数组的点积。

代码#1:

# Python program explaining
# numpy.ndarray.dot() function
  
# importing numpy as geek 
import numpy as geek
  
arr1 = geek.eye(3)
arr = geek.ones((3, 3)) * 3
  
gfg = arr1.dot( arr )
  
print( gfg)

输出 :

[[ 3.  3.  3.]
 [ 3.  3.  3.]
 [ 3.  3.  3.]]

代码#2:

# Python program explaining
# numpy.ndarray.dot() function
  
# importing numpy as geek 
import numpy as geek
  
arr1 = geek.eye(3)
arr = geek.ones((3, 3)) * 3
  
gfg = arr1.dot(arr).dot(arr)
  
print( gfg)

输出 :

[[ 27.  27.  27.]
 [ 27.  27.  27.]
 [ 27.  27.  27.]]

Python教程

Java教程

Web教程

数据库教程

图形图像教程

大数据教程

开发工具教程

计算机教程